> Reconnect backoff time randomisation. In case of broker global disconect, to avoid all client connecting again at the very same moment. It would be good to have some randomisation in retry time, configurable.
> Also, clients could have their own logic of reconnect that could cause lot of reconnect. It would be good to have ability to limit the rate of new connection creation, configurable.
